Summary:
Provides introduction to the HOME investment partnerships program, which provides housing assistance to State and local governments exclusively for affordable housing activities to benefit low-income households. Examines recent developments, program history, funding mechanism, eligible activities, and program requirements; and provides information on recent trends in the appropriation and use of HOME funds. Addresses current issues related to HOME program oversight and proposed rule on HOME program issued in Dec. 2011. Includes tables and graphs.
